What is an Oven with Built-In Microwave?
An oven with a built-in microwave is a kitchen area appliance that integrates both traditional cooking and microwave heating performances. This appliance permits users to bake, roast, and grill meals while using the alternative to microwave food for quick reheating or cooking, making it a versatile addition to any kitchen.
Benefits of an Oven with Built-In Microwave
Area Saving: One of the most considerable advantages of this type of device is that it integrates two cooking functions into one system, eliminating the requirement for a different microwave. This is especially helpful for kitchens with limited area.

Versatile Cooking Options: Users can bake and roast as they would in a conventional oven or use the microwave function for quicker cooking. This adaptability enables a more comprehensive variety of cooking styles and meal preparation.

Energy Efficient: A built-in microwave typically consumes less energy than running a conventional oven for extended periods. The microwave function can considerably reduce cooking times for particular dishes, adding to lower energy usage.

Modern Aesthetic: Built-in devices offer a sleek, modern-day appearance that can enhance the general aesthetic of your cooking area. They can be effortlessly integrated into kitchen cabinetry for a customized look.

Time Saving: With the capability to switch in between cooking techniques, meal preparation ends up being faster and more efficient. For instance, a meal can be pre-cooked in the microwave and finished in the oven for an even cook.
Key Features to Look For
When considering an oven with a built-in microwave, prospective purchasers need to take note of the following features:
Size and Capacity: Look for an oven with a suitable size that fits your cooking area space and satisfies your cooking needs.Cooking Functions: Ensure that the home appliance has several cooking choices, including baking, broiling, roasting, thawing, and reheating.Control Panel: An user-friendly control panel with clear settings will make cooking more instinctive.Safety Features: Look for functions like child locks, vehicle shut-off, and security indicators to guarantee safe operation, particularly in homes with children.Self-Cleaning Option: This feature is beneficial for simple upkeep and guarantees your oven remains in top condition with very little effort.Convection Options: Ovens with convection abilities can distribute hot air around food, permitting even cooking and browning.Contrast of Popular Models

3. What are the installation requirements for this device?
Installation normally needs a designated area in your kitchen area cabinetry, electrical connections, and possibly ventilation considerations if it's a wall-mounted model. Constantly seek advice from a professional installer to ensure appropriate setup.
4. Do built-in microwaves have the same cooking power as standalone microwaves?
While built-in microwaves can have similar wattage to standalone models, their cooking performance may differ based on style, size, and innovation. Always check individual specifications.
5. How do I keep an oven with a built-in microwave?
Routinely clean the interior, consisting of the microwave function, and follow the manufacturer's suggestions for upkeep. Features like self-cleaning can simplify this task.
